加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.023zz.com/)- 智能内容、大数据、数据可视化、人脸识别、图像分析!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

MsSql存储触发器无障碍设计精要

发布时间:2026-03-18 10:05:29 所属栏目:MsSql教程 来源:DaWei
导读:  MsSql存储触发器是数据库中用于自动执行特定操作的机制,当表中的数据发生更改时,触发器可以自动响应。无障碍设计在触发器开发中同样重要,确保其逻辑清晰、易于维护和理解。  在编写触发器时,应避免复杂的嵌

  MsSql存储触发器是数据库中用于自动执行特定操作的机制,当表中的数据发生更改时,触发器可以自动响应。无障碍设计在触发器开发中同样重要,确保其逻辑清晰、易于维护和理解。


  在编写触发器时,应避免复杂的嵌套逻辑。过于复杂的结构会增加调试难度,并可能导致不可预见的错误。保持触发器的功能单一化,有助于提高代码的可读性和稳定性。


  使用适当的注释是无障碍设计的关键。即使是最简单的触发器,也应包含简要说明其功能和作用的注释。这不仅帮助其他开发者理解代码,也有助于未来维护时快速定位问题。


AI生成的效果图,仅供参考

  遵循一致的命名规范可以显著提升触发器的可读性。例如,使用“tr_”作为触发器前缀,加上相关表名和操作类型,如“tr_UpdateOrder”,有助于快速识别触发器的用途。


  测试是确保触发器无障碍的重要步骤。应在不同场景下验证触发器的行为,包括正常数据插入、更新和删除,以及异常情况。充分的测试能减少生产环境中的潜在风险。


  合理使用事务控制可以避免因触发器执行失败而导致的数据不一致。在需要保证数据完整性的场景中,应将触发器操作纳入事务处理流程。


  定期审查和优化触发器代码也是无障碍设计的一部分。随着业务需求的变化,原有的触发器可能不再适用,及时调整可以防止系统性能下降或逻辑错误。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章